Background
The mortality rate of colorectal cancer (CRC) remains high in developing countries. Interventions that can inhibit the proliferation of tumor cells represent promising strategies in CRC treatment. Deltex E3 ubiquitin ligase 3 (DTX3) plays an essential role in tumor development and may predict the outcome of cancer patients. This study aimed to investigate the regulatory mechanisms of DTX3 in CRC progression.
Methods and results
The expression of DTX3 was significantly downregulated in CRC tissues relative to normal colorectal tissues. DTX3 overexpression inhibited, while DTX3 knockout promoted the colony-forming capacity and proliferation of CRC cells. E2F transcription factor 1 (E2F1) is a key mediator of cell cycle progression that participates in the progression, metastasis, and chemoresistance of CRC. Further analysis revealed that DTX3 regulated the transcriptional activity of E2F1 in CRC cells. The transcription by E2F1 was significantly reduced with the increase in the cellular level of DTX3, while DTX3 knockout exerted an opposite effect. DTX3 knockout also increased the expression of E2F1 target genes involved in cell cycle progression, CDC2 and Cyclin D3, while PD 0332991, an inhibitor of E2F1 transcription, inhibited the expression of both proteins.
Conclusions
In conclusion, DTX3 regulated CRC cell growth via regulating E2F1 and its downstream genes. These findings support further exploration of DTX3 as a potential therapeutic target for CRC.
